SALT LAKE CITY â Just a couple blocks off busy North Temple Street on Salt Lake Cityâs west side, sits an architectural gem.
It was built around 1900 by the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, and served as the 15
th Ward up until the late 1960âs.
But for the last 40 years or so itâs been used as a recording studio.
âCarole King had recorded there, and a lot of big people had recorded there, and theyâd just live in the apartment up above,â said Bryan Hofheins, a musician, composer, and owner of Non-Stop Music and L.A. East studios which operated out of the church up until a couple years ago.
